2.54 mm DIL Spring-Loaded Contacts, Surface Mount Pad


These Preci-dip DIL 813-S1 Series low resistance modular connectors have spring-loaded contacts (SLC) with surface mount pads.

The Height dimension gives the initial height of the spring-loaded contacts

The plastic body height is 4 mm

The plunger stroke length is 1.4 mm

Preci-dip Spring-Loaded Connectors


A perfect alternative to conventional connection solutions. The electrical multipoint connection between the mobile piston and the clip guarantees low, stable electrical resistance values without micro-discontinuities, even when the piston is moving or vibrating, thus assuring maximum reliability.
